Dstar Lite

소프트웨어 스크린 샷:
Dstar Lite
소프트웨어 정보:
버전: 1.0
업로드 날짜: 3 Jun 15
개발자: James Neufeld
라이센스: 무료
인기: 66

Rating: 1.0/5 (Total Votes: 1)

DSTAR 라이트 [코닉 2002]에서 설명한 바와 같이 D * 라이트 알고리즘의 구현은 C이다.
계산 시간 및 경로 거리를 개선하기 위해이 코드에 몇 가지 사소한 수정이 있습니다. 이 소프트웨어의 매우 간단한 조각 이해하고 통합 할 수있는 약간의 시간이 소요됩니다.
명령 :
[Q / 질문] - 종료
[R / R] - Replan
[/] - 토글 자동 Replan
[C / C] - 클리어 (다시 시작)
마우스 왼쪽 클릭 - 만드는 세포 untraversable 비용 (-1)
중간 마우스 클릭 - 셀에 목표를 이동
오른쪽 마우스 클릭 - 셀에 시작 이동
다음과 같이 셀의 색상은 다음과 같습니다 :
레드 - untraversable
녹색 -에 이동하지만 변경된 비용
레드 / 작은 보라색 사각형 녹색 - 셀은 openList에
셀을 시작 - 노란색
퍼플 - 골 세포
자신의 소스에 사용 :
여기에 DSTAR 클래스를 사용하는 간단한 작업 테스트 프로그램은 다음과 같습니다
사용법 #include "Dstar.h"
() {int로 주
 DSTAR * DSTAR = 새로운 DSTAR ();
 목록 MYPATH;
 dstar-> INIT (0,0,10,5) // 설정에 시작 (0,0) 및에 목표 (10,5)
 dstar-> updateCell (3,4, -1); // 설정 셀 (3,4)는 비에 이동 할 수
 dstar-> updateCell (2,2,42.432); 설정 // 세트 (2,2) 42.432 비용을 가지고
 dstar-> replan (); // 경로를 계획
 MYPATH = dstar->에있는, getPath (); 경로를 검색 //
 dstar-> updateStart (10,2); 시작을 이동 // (10,2)
 dstar-> replan (); // 경로를 계획
 MYPATH = dstar->에있는, getPath (); 경로를 검색 //
 dstar-> updateGoal (0,1); 에 // 이동​​ 목표 (0,1)
 dstar-> replan (); // 경로를 계획
 MYPATH = dstar->에있는, getPath (); 경로를 검색 //
 
 0을 반환;
}

유사한 소프트웨어

MESH
MESH

3 Jun 15

PDL
PDL

15 Apr 15

FLENS
FLENS

20 Feb 15

Zasio
Zasio

3 Jun 15

코멘트 Dstar Lite

댓글을 찾을 수 없습니다
코멘트를 추가
이미지를 켜십시오!